EC 6.2.1.25                 Enzyme                                 

Name benzoate---CoA ligase;
benzoate---coenzyme A ligase;
benzoyl-coenzyme A synthetase;
benzoyl CoA synthetase (AMP forming)
Class Ligases;
Forming carbon-sulfur bonds;
Acid-thiol ligases
BRITE hierarchy
Sysname benzoate:CoA ligase (AMP-forming)
Reaction(IUBMB) ATP + benzoate + CoA = AMP + diphosphate + benzoyl-CoA [RN:R01422]

Comment Also acts on 2-, 3- and 4-fluorobenzoate, but only very slowly on
the corresponding chlorobenzoates.
